Stock Context
Newmont reported Q4 2025 EPS of $2.52, beating estimates by $0.71, with net margin of 31.25% and revenue of $6.82 billion. The company's Q1 2026 earnings are scheduled for April 23, 2026, with analysts projecting EPS of $2.15. The recent pullback reflects 'sell-the-news' sentiment following 2026 production guidance flagged as a 'trough year'. However, Newmont is positioned to increase its dividend or initiate a multi-billion dollar share buyback program in late 2026 after deleveraging with $4.3 billion in asset sales. Insider selling pressure exists with 9 of 9 insider trades being sales over the past six months. Wall Street maintains 'Strong Buy' consensus with a median price target of $145.00, suggesting the downgrade is an outlier.

Risk Factors
A recent downgrade from National Bank to 'Sector Perform' signals analyst conviction shift amid rising costs tied to higher diesel prices. Investors are revisiting 2026 guidance for lower production volumes and higher all-in sustaining costs, a combination that pressures valuations during gold price weakness. Crucially, Q1 earnings are due April 23—just three trading days after this analysis date—creating binary event risk that could trigger sharp moves. Sustained insider selling (9 consecutive sales) suggests insiders lack conviction. Macro headwinds persist: gold prices have faced recent pressure from geopolitical tensions and dollar strength, creating downside volatility risk. Beta of 0.56 offers moderate downside protection in risk-off scenarios but limits upside participation if metals rally broadly.
How We Find and Score This Setup
We scan more than 6,000 NYSE and NASDAQ stocks every trading day and compare each detected pattern against a database of 370,000+ historical detections. Every setup is scored across three dimensions: Structure, Volume, and Breakout Readiness. Win probability is a calibrated estimate of how similar historical setups performed over the following 10 trading days. This is a swing trading tool built for multi-day holds. It is not built or tested for day trading.
